Nevada Highway Patrol released the name of a 19-year-old who died Oct. 23 in a car rollover in Summerlin.
Alexander Lawrence, 19, of Las Vegas, was driving a white 2008 Toyota FJ Cruiser traveling eastbound on Summerlin Parkway west of Buffalo around 10:08 p.m. when the accident occurred, officials said.
Lawrence lost control of the Toyota that rotated clockwise and traveled off the right edge of the roadway, the highway patrol said.
Lawrence, who wasn’t wearing a seatbelt, was thrown from the vehicle and pronounced dead at the scene, officials said.
Two male passengers, ages 17 and 18, were transported to University Medical Center with minor injuries, officials said.
